Sinopse

"Language Shapes Thought" explores the intricate connection between language and our cognitive processes, examining how linguistic structures influence our perception of reality and shape cultural norms. It investigates the age-old question of whether the language we speak affects how we think, delving into the nuances of linguistic relativity and its implications for cognitive frameworks.

 
One intriguing insight is how different languages impact spatial reasoning and time perception, demonstrating that our native tongue may subtly alter our understanding of the world. The book progresses from foundational theories to specific linguistic features, such as grammatical gender and tense systems, analyzing their cognitive impact.

 
It highlights empirical studies, cross-linguistic comparisons, and neuroimaging research to support its arguments. The book uniquely emphasizes the practical applications of linguistic relativity, bridging the gap between theoretical research and real-world scenarios. This approach makes the book valuable for educators and policymakers, offering insights into improving language education and cross-cultural communication strategies.

    The Basques are an ethnic group indigenous to Southwestern Europe, distinguished by their unique genetic heritage, ancient language (Euskara), and distinct cultural practices. Their homeland, known as the Basque Country (Euskal Herria), spans both sides of the Pyrenees, covering areas in north-central Spain and southwestern France, and lies along the Bay of Biscay. Basque identity traces back to ancient populations, such as the Vascones and Aquitanians, resulting in a rich and enduring cultural legacy that remains highly distinctive even today. 
    In recent years, advances in genetic research have provided remarkable insights into Basque origins. A pivotal study published in 2015 revealed that the Basques are primarily descended from Neolithic farmers who arrived in the Iberian Peninsula thousands of years ago. These early agriculturalists intermingled with the local Mesolithic hunter-gatherers in the region but later became genetically isolated, diverging significantly from other European populations over millennia. This long-standing genetic isolation has likely contributed to the unique characteristics of the Basque people and their differentiation from surrounding groups.
